    To be honest, the Watch does not pair with the vehicle. The vehicle pairs with the phone, and the ability to download the phonebook depends on the setting in the vehicle, and then another setting in Bluetooth when you are looking at the in the vehicle connection.

     

    There is no way for the vehicle and the watch to pair with each other. I would try removing the phone from the vehicle's Bluetooth list, and then remove the vehicle from the phone's Bluetooth list. Do a reset on the phone, holding the sleep/wake and home buttons together until you see the Apple logo and then release. The phone should reboot. After that, put the vehicle's system into discovery/pairing mode, and then turn Bluetooth on for the phone and follow the on-screen instructions to pair the two together.

     

    I've never experienced, nor have I seen anyone report an issue with the watch and a vehicle interfering with phonebook downloads, and I have an Apple Watch with my iPhone 6s, and the phone is paired to the watch and my Hyundai.
